Comment on: Oracle bans AI-generated code from OpenJDK
I have my doubts about this. Brands are a about reputation, and reputation strongly affects responsibility when business decisions are made. If a manager decides to vibecode a solution which eventually fails, said manager will be punished. If instead a mainstream software is bought, and it fails - well, everybody has the same trouble around, right? It's not a personal mistake anymore. I suppose there are niches where branded software may give way, but I don't think it's gonna be a general trend.
